Transaction 171ea023d2173e05c31c3bdd266d02b95b67d639cacc40d8f900a59b62ed3614

1 Input
2 Outputs
  • 171ea023d2173e05c31c3bdd266d02b95b67d639cacc40d8f900a59b62ed3614:0
  • value  100000000
    address  1ERbJSwgTYZnsNq8QPFngkag6shDiuvXM8
  • 171ea023d2173e05c31c3bdd266d02b95b67d639cacc40d8f900a59b62ed3614:1
  • value  1799684817
    address  1Ab8AXaJNmscBSRnuFrHffD5bNCJEkTnmp